Heading off Conflict Within the Church
Why is it that when one thinks of church they typically think of a safe haven, free from strife and problems. Anyone that has spent any time around a church organization knows the church has problems and issues just like any other business entity does, sometimes they are of a far more personal nature. Ken Gangel's book Communication and Conflict Management in Churches and Christian Organizations was a required text in a Masters of Theology course. In his book he deals with the very real and often harsh problems that can be found in a church environment, examples that include real life scenarios that people can easily relate to as they move through the book.I have been through a number of Conflict Management courses during my career in Corporate America and was definitely able to tie prior training and personal experiences into what Gangel relates in this book as well as bring those experiences from life into the classroom. This book is yet another resource that will sit worthily on my shelf of references and one that I would highly recommend to any pastor, church leadership, and volunteer coordinators alike.
